This Helmar “This Great Game” card honors Yogi Berra, the beloved catcher and three-time
American League MVP who became a cornerstone of the New York Yankees dynasty. Berra
is shown in his familiar batting stance, ready for action in the Yankees’ iconic pinstripes. The
portrait’s soft hues, balanced by a sunrise gradient and bold team header, evoke mid-century
baseball card aesthetics while retaining Helmar’s distinctive hand-painted realism. Each
brushstroke captures Berra’s blend of grit, focus, and charm—qualities that defined both his
play and his enduring legend.


On the reverse, Helmar transforms Berra’s image into a psychedelic celebration of baseball
motion and color. The vividly stylized composition—anchored by the phrase “Pop Out to Yogi
Berra”—echoes the vibrant, experimental graphics of the late 1960s. Card No. 96 beautifully
bridges the golden era of Yankees baseball with the modern artistic imagination, capturing
Berra’s timeless appeal through Helmar’s signature combination of nostalgia and
craftsmanship.


Original gouache painting by Sanjay Verma.
